G9 vs G16 starter
Are they by chance the same/interchangeable? What I have found on a quick internet search is they appear to be different.
Anyone swapped them? |

Re: G9 vs G16 starter
You can do it. You should swap your pulley (and any spacer behind it). If putting it on a G9, use the G9 pulley. Copy the wiring from the cart your Installing it on. Will have to slightly modify the red & green Exciter wires (one uses a plug, the other uses 2 bullet connectors). Check charging voltage when done to ensure Exciter wiring polarity is correct. If voltage goes up when engine is running, it's correct. If voltage drops when it's running, polarity is backwards.
